Sacramento UNITY Program

Stay tuned for 2026 applications!
2025 APPLICATIONS CLOSED

About the Program

The program builds bridges among Asian, Latino, Black, and Native communities while cultivating a new generation of leaders prepared for public service. Through this initiative, hosted in partnership with Sacramento Mayor Pro Tem Mai Vang, participants develop the skills, relationships, and civic readiness to strengthen cross-community leadership in the region.

​The program equips students with the tools to cultivate confidence, discipline, and essential skills for navigating high school, preparing for graduation, and succeeding in college. Speakers serve as role models, inspiring students to pursue their own success and become community leaders. Success stories shared by these role models inspire students to tap into their own abilities.

Scholarship: All accepted program participants will receive a $150 cash scholarship. Program participants are also eligible to apply for the Lydia Cruz Scholarship.

Target Students: High school juniors or seniors of Asian American, Native Hawaiian, Pacific Islander, Chicano/a, Latino/a, Black/African American, Native American/Indigenous descent.
